Fundamental Critical Care Support (FCCS) Course
September 29-30, 2010 @ The Molly Blank Center on the campus of National Jewish Health, Denver, CO
This course is the only nationally and internationally recognized course in basic critical care. This course is sponsored under a license forwarded by the Society of Critical Care Medicine.
Target Audience:
Advanced Practice Nurses, Critical Care Fellows in their first year, Emergency Medicine Physicians, Hospital Physicians, Pre-hospital Providers w/lengthy transport, Primary Care Physicians, Physician Assistants, Registered Nurses, Respiratory Therapists, Residents-in Training, and Clinical Pharmacists.
Course Objectives:
- Immediately assess the needs of the critically ill patient.
- Identify appropriate diagnostic tests for the critically ill patient.
- Respond to significant changes in an unstable patient.
- Initiate management of acute life-threatening conditions.
- Recognize the need for expert consultation and/or patient transport.
- Prepare the critically ill patient for optimally supported transport.
- Perform hands-on skills in real-time.
Course Director: Michael Schwartz, MD, Medical Director Critical Care

Physician Instructor Requirements:
- Full SCCM membership
- Successful completion of the provider and instructor components of the FCCS course
- Specialty board certification/special/added qualifications or eligibility in critical care as applicable, OR
- 50% of clinical practice in critical care as supported by a letter from the medical or intensive care director, attached to the instructor application
